Title of article :
Synthesis of Polyfunctional Dendrimeric Type Copolymer as the Hydrogels and Investigation of their Thermoreversible Behaviours.

Abstract :
The syntheses of a novel telechelic polymer and a polyfunctional dendrimeric copolymer were achieved. For the synthesis of telechelic polymer, first a diacid of poly(ethylene glycol) was chlorinated using thionyl chloride. Then 5-aminosalicylic acid (5-ASA) was reacted with diacyl halide poly(ethylene glycol). The resulting polymer containing drug molecule (5-ASA) (1) reacted with dicyclohexyl carbodiimide (DCC) in dichloromethane and a polyfunctional copolymer (2) was obtained. The GPC measurements confirmed the formation of a pentamer containing telechelic blocks type compound. The thermoreversible behaviours of the prepared hydrogels of both telechelic polymer and the polyfunctional dendrimeric copolymer have been investigated. The thermoreversible behaviour of telechelic polymer 1 in water was almost in contrast to the thermoreversible behaviour of compound 2. The structure definition and analysis of the synthesized new compounds was carried out using NMR, FTIR, UV-Vis spectrometry, optical microscopy and viscosimetry methods.
